Hope4Paws UK & Spanish Rescue (also known as H4P) is currently a social enterprise rescuing dogs who have faced cruelty and abandonment in Spain. Our goal is to get as many of these dogs out of these situations and into homes within the UK. We have big goals and hope for you all to join us on the adventure to a better world. We have adopted over 100 dogs within a year of being open. We use the 3 R’s to ensure our dogs are ready to join a home with you (Rescue, Rehabilitation, and Rehome.) We are a family here at H4P built for a good cause, which are the survivors of Spain. This all started with one beautiful dog Loki and his owner Michelle. Michelle started this off after seeing what Loki had gone through and here we are now. We look forward to what lies ahead. Thank you.

Based on my personal experience, I would strongly advise anyone considering adopting or fostering through H4P to do extensive research, ask detailed questions, and request complete veterinary records, behavioural assessments and copies of the dog’s passport before making any commitment.
I was fortunate that I chose to foster before deciding whether to adopt. Had I adopted Leon outright, the outcome could have been very different.
Leon was described as a 4-year-old dog. When he arrived in the UK, his passport showed he was actually 7 years old. He was also far larger than he appeared in the photographs.
After travelling for over 24 hours from Spain, Leon arrived exhausted, emotionally shut down and in poor physical health. Despite this, he was one of the sweetest dogs I have ever met. My concerns were never about his temperament, but about his health, emotional wellbeing and the conditions he had clearly experienced before arriving in the UK.
I agreed to foster Leon for three weeks but extended this to seven. Unfortunately, he became increasingly withdrawn. I raised my concerns with Michelle and Kerry, expecting we would discuss the best way forward. Instead, his adopter was asked to collect him the following day. Although I offered to continue fostering him so proper transport arrangements could be made and he could continue to decompress, my offer was declined.
The adopter and her friend drove four hours to collect Leon in a Mini Cooper. Her friend was recovering from throat cancer. Before Leon left, I informed the adopter that his passport showed he was older than she had been told and shared my concerns about his health.
Six weeks later I was informed Leon had escaped on the day he was collected and remained missing for two days before being found.
What shocked me most was learning that the adopter had allegedly been told Leon was “in danger” in my care and that I had been feeding him raw chicken. These allegations are completely false.
I took a week off work to care for Leon, slept on my sofa so he wouldn’t be alone, hand-fed him cooked chicken because he was reluctant to eat, paid around £70 for his food and bought my own slip lead because none had been provided.
I have photographs, videos, receipts and messages documenting the care Leon received.
I was also disappointed to learn Leon was later removed from his adopter after being found.
I was further upset to see H4P publish what I believe to be an inaccurate version of events on Facebook, using a photograph taken in my own living room while Leon was in my care, captioned “Leon after”.
Everything I have written is based on my firsthand experience or information communicated directly to me, and I have retained documentation supporting my account.
Based on my experience, I believe there is a lack of transparency regarding some dogs’ ages, medical histories, behavioural backgrounds and health conditions. I also believe adopters should be fully informed if a dog has leishmaniasis, as it may require lifelong treatment and may not be covered by insurance as a pre-existing condition.
Update following H4P’s response: H4P have confirmed they do not receive a dog’s passport until it is ready to travel, meaning basic information such as age is not verified before placement. They also incorrectly state they refused my request for a puppy and that I was removed and blocked from their groups. In fact, they told me they had no puppies but offered to arrange transport if I found one in Spain. I left the groups voluntarily and blocked the organisation myself.
I have enormous respect for ethical rescue organisations and the volunteers who dedicate themselves to helping animals. Unfortunately, my experience with H4P was the opposite. Above all, I hope Leon is finally safe and receiving the loving home he always deserved.
